The Ghost Howls’s VR Week Peek (2019.06.23): HTC teases the Vive Cosmos, Oculus announces AR at OC6 and much more!

The Ghost Howls

HTC has revealed the design of the Vive Cosmos. HTC has finally unveiled some information on the Vive Cosmos. HTC has told in the past that this is a headset more consumer-oriented , but Sebastian Ang of Mixed Reality TV has reported that, according to a reliable source, the price will be 899.
